No Bake Chocolate Mousse Pie

Indulge in the decadence of this No Bake Chocolate Mousse Pie—an effortless dessert that’s as stunning as it is delicious. Featuring a buttery graham cracker crust and a rich, airy chocolate mousse filling, this recipe is a no-bake dream come true, perfect for entertaining or satisfying a sweet tooth. Made with simple ingredients like semi-sweet chocolate chips, heavy cream, and vanilla extract, the mousse achieves its silky-smooth texture without the need for eggs or baking. The pie sets beautifully in the refrigerator and can be topped with fresh whipped cream and chocolate shavings for an impressive presentation. With minimal prep time and zero oven required, this chilled chocolate dessert is ideal for warm weather gatherings or anytime you crave a fuss-free treat.

🥘 Ingredients

9 items
  • 1.5 cups Graham cracker crumbs
  • 6 tablespoons Un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 tablespoons Granulated sugar
  • 1.5 cups Sem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 2 cups Heavy cream, divided
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ract
  • 2 tablespoons Powdered sugar
  • 1 cup Whipped cream (optional, for topping)
  • 2 tablespoons Chocolate shavings (optional, for garnish)

📝 Instructions

9 steps
1

In a medium-sized mixing bowl, combine the graham cracker crumbs, melted butter, and granulated sugar. Mix until the crumbs are evenly coated and resemble wet sand.

2

Press the crumb mixture into the bottom and sides of a 9-inch pie dish to form an even crust. Use the back of a measuring cup to press it firmly in place. Chill in the refrigerator while preparing the filling.

3

In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the semi-sweet chocolate chips in 30-second intervals, stirring after each, until completely smooth. Allow the melted chocolate to cool slightly.

4

In a large mixing bowl, whip 1 1/2 cups of heavy cream using a hand or stand mixer until soft peaks form. Add the vanilla extract and powdered sugar, then whip until stiff peaks form.

5

Gently fold the melted chocolate into the whipped cream in batches, making sure to mix just until combined to maintain a light and airy texture. This creates the chocolate mousse filling.

6

Remove the prepared crust from the refrigerator and spoon the chocolate mousse filling into the crust. Smooth the surface with a spatula.

7

Chill the pie in the refrigerator for at least 4 hours, or until fully set.

8

Before serving, whip the remaining 1/2 cup of heavy cream to soft peaks and use it to decorate the top of the pie. Add optional chocolate shavings for garnish.

9

Slice and serve chilled.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
